I encounter this error too, and in my experience, it appears to be related to attempting to go into orbit to access a different space platform than the one you initially accessed with a VTOL. So -

Let's say you made Platform 1 on Nauvis, then used the VTOL to access it. You then moved that platform to Vulcanus, and made a new platform (Platform 2) on Nauvis. When attempting to access Platform 2, you will crash. However, if you attempt to access Platform 1 on Vulcanus, you'll be fine. In most cases, you won't crash when attempting to access the surface from that VTOL, however.
